When Ultra-Pure Water Depends on Precise Ion Control

Laboratories, pharmaceutical production lines, and electronics manufacturing facilities do not measure water quality in the same terms as residential systems. Conductivity, total dissolved solids, and ionic contamination must meet strict tolerances that change based on application and regulation. When a process requires deionized water, the cation stage is not optional, it is foundational. The DI-FUSION™ Cation Tank 14X47 addresses the first critical separation in high-purity water systems: removing dissolved cations before they reach downstream resin or mixed-bed polishing stages.

This tank is filled with 3.6 cubic feet of Purolite™ PFC100 cation exchange resin, a media specifically engineered for high-capacity ion removal in demanding environments. Unlike standard water softening resin, PFC100 targets the full spectrum of positively charged ions including calcium, magnesium, sodium, potassium, iron, manganese, and trace metals including lead, copper, zinc, and aluminum. Water enters the tank, flows through the resin bed, and exchanges cations for hydrogen ions. The result is water with drastically reduced cation load, protecting downstream stages from premature exhaustion and maintaining consistent TDS control across service cycles. Each tank is assembled in the USA using corrosion-resistant materials, precision inlet and outlet distribution, and bed support designed to prevent channeling under commercial flow rates. How Cation Exchange Protects the Entire Deionization System

In a two-bed or multi-stage deionization setup, the cation tank performs the first ion removal step. Water flows through the PFC100 resin bed, where dissolved cations are selectively exchanged for hydrogen ions. This reduces the cation load before water reaches the anion or mixed-bed stage, extending service life and improving regeneration efficiency. When cation exchange is performed correctly at this stage, downstream resin operates within design capacity, TDS breakthrough is minimized, and regeneration schedules become predictable.

The 14-inch by 47-inch tank dimensions are suited for moderate to high flow applications where contact time and exchange capacity must remain consistent. The 3.6 cubic feet of PFC100 resin provides the volume needed to handle fluctuating inlet water quality without compromising removal efficiency. Because cation resin can be regenerated using acid, this stage allows for cost-effective operation when managed within a structured maintenance schedule. Operators can monitor conductivity and TDS at multiple points within the system to determine when regeneration is required, ensuring that water quality remains within specification at all times. This tank integrates into existing DI systems or serves as the cation component in newly designed setups, pairing with anion tanks, mixed-bed polishing units, and carbon pretreatment vessels to form a complete high-purity solution. For businesses that depend on consistent water quality for pharmaceutical formulation, equipment cooling, or precision electronics rinsing, this cation stage is essential.
